One unit of a metal tube assembly identified by NSN 4710015798988 is being supplied under a subcontract issued by the Defense Logistics Agency on behalf of the Department of Defense. The item must comply with established military specifications and is to be delivered FOB destination to Fort Hood, Texas. The contract was posted on July 16, 2026, and falls under the NAICS code 332439, which corresponds to other fabricated metal product manufacturing. The delivery location is specified but the originating office and point of contact details are not provided. The contract is linked via the DIBBS system for award tracking and fulfillment.

129th Tumbler Cups
Solicitation # W50S8X26QA026
The California Air National Guard is soliciting quotes under solicitation W50S8X26QA026 for the procurement of 1,000 custom-engraved 30 oz stainless steel tumbler cups. This acquisition is a 100% set-aside for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Businesses (SDVOSB). The required tumblers must be black, BPA-free, dishwasher safe, and feature a double-wall vacuum insulation, a 3-position screw-on lid, a handle, and a reusable straw, conforming to Stanley brand specifications or an approved equal. Each cup must be laser-engraved with the California Air National Guard logo centered on the front, measuring approximately 2.5 by 1.5 inches. The contract requires split-shipment logistics with delivery to four distinct California military recruiting locations: Sunnyvale (300 units), Fresno (200 units), Oxnard (200 units), and March ARB (300 units). All shipments must be delivered F.O.B. Destination on or before September 30, 2026, with all shipping costs incorporated into the fully burdened unit prices. The government will award a single firm-fixed-price purchase order based on the Lowest Price Technically Acceptable (LPTA) solution, evaluating quotes on a pass/fail basis for technical capability and past performance. Quotes must be submitted electronically to the Contracting Officer by September 14, 2026, at 12:00 PM local time. Submissions must be organized into four volumes, including a technical capability volume limited to five pages and an administrative volume verifying SDVOSB status via SAM.gov. Payment will be processed electronically through the Wide Area WorkFlow (WAWF) system. Compliance with MIL-STD-130 and MIL-STD-129 for marking and labeling is required, and the contract incorporates various FAR and DFARS clauses, including the Buy American-Free Trade Agreements-Israeli Trade Act.

BATTERY, STORAGE
Solicitation # SPE7L7-26-Q-2418
Solicitation SPE7L7-26-Q-2418 is a firm-fixed-price request for quotations issued by the Defense Logistics Agency Land and Maritime for the procurement of sealed lead acid storage batteries, identified by NSN 6140-01-624-9682. The requirement consists of two line items totaling eight units, with two units for item 0001 and six units for item 0002. Approved sources include EnerSys Delaware Inc. (part numbers ODS-AGM6M or PC2250) and Stored Energy Products, Inc. (part number PC2250). These items are designated as critical application items and are restricted source items requiring engineering source approval by the government design control activity. The batteries are classified as Type I (Code H) with a non-extendable shelf life of 12 months. Delivery is required within 60 days after receipt of the order, with shipping terms set as FOB Destination. Packaging and marking must comply with MIL-STD-2073-1E, MIL-STD-129, and DLA packaging requirements RP001, while hazardous materials must be handled according to IP025 and FAR 52.223-3. Quality assurance will be managed through destination inspection and acceptance using sampling methods such as MIL-STD-1916 or ASQ H1331. Award will be based on cost alone for quotes that conform to the solicitation requirements. Quotations must be submitted by September 21, 2026, and payment will be processed electronically via the Wide Area WorkFlow system.
